FRIDAY 5 THE HARD WAY
6/21/13

1. What quotation is inscribed on the tombstone of Martin Luther King?

"FREE AT LAST, FREE AT LAST, THANK GOD ALMIGHTY, I'M FREE AT LAST."

2. Can you name the Portuguese navigator and explorer who led the first expedition to circumnavigate the earth, in 1519?

FERDINAND MAGELLAN

3. In this 1940s play, a salesman named Willy Loman feels useless in his occupation and kills himself. What is the title of this play and which husband of Marilyn Monroe wrote it?

DEATH OF A SALESMAN / ARTHUR MILLER

4. Yes, you can look at the one dollar bill and answer this question: how many times does the word or number "1" appear on every U.S. one dollar bill?

16 TIMES

5. What is the common name for the temperature 273 degrees below zero, centigrade (460 degrees below zero, Fahrenheit)?

ABSOLUTE ZERO the lowest theoretical temperature, representing the complete absence of heat.
